Biography

Yusuke Yasuda received his BS and MS degrees at Waseda University, Japan, in 2012 and 2014, respectively. He received his Ph.D degree from the Graduate University for Advanced Studies, SOKENDAI, Japan, in 2021. He was a research assistant at the National Institute of Informatics, Japan, from 2018 to 2021. From 2021 to 2025, he was a project lecturer at Nagoya University, Japan. Since 2025, he has been a project assistant professor at the National Institute of Informatics, Japan. He received the second Yoshida Award from the Acoustical Society of Japan in 2023. His research interests include machine learning, speech synthesis, and speech evaluation.
